In Australia, a full time Chemical Engineer generally earns $2,150 per week ($111,800 annual salary) before tax. This is a median figure for full-time employees and should be considered a guide only. As you gain more experience you can expect a potentially higher salary than people who are new to the industry.
This industry is expected to see a strong increase in employment numbers in coming years. There are currently 4,600 people working in this field in Australia and many of them specialise as a Chemical Engineer. Chemical Engineers may find work across all regions of Australia, particularly larger towns and cities.
Source: Australian Government Labour Market Insights
If you’re planning a career as a Chemical Engineer, consider enrolling in a Bachelor of Engineering (Chemical) (Honours). This course covers a range of topics including engineering mathematics, engineering drawing and CAD, materials and manufacturing, energy and resource engineering, chemistry, fluid mechanics, thermodynamics and heat and mass transfer.

Beyond traditional chemical engineering roles, completing these courses can lead to exciting career paths such as a Nanotechnologist, responsible for manipulating matter at the molecular level, or a Process Control Engineer, who designs and manages processes in manufacturing environments. Other opportunities include becoming a Plastics Engineer, focusing on the development of plastic products, or a Corrosion Engineer, dedicated to preventing material degradation over time.
